Output ad3902959c94b32889820539ade53a8edbb5e53cacd1e6fe7804b31b9d264b49:0

value
560556189
script pubkey
OP_0 OP_PUSHBYTES_20 e18f27908bdbc6b3f83e876a6297cdc9ec968093
address
bc1qux8j0yytm0rt87p7sa4x997de8kfdqynanykxm
transaction
ad3902959c94b32889820539ade53a8edbb5e53cacd1e6fe7804b31b9d264b49
spent
true